## Report on Union Territory Goods and Services Tax Act Amendment - Notification No. 02/2021
**1. Executive Summary:**
This report analyzes Notification No. 02/2021, an amendment to the Government of India's No. 11/2017 Union Territory Tax Rate notification. The amendment, effective June 2nd, 2021, primarily addresses input tax credit eligibility for landowner-promoters in real estate projects and introduces specific tax rates for maintenance, repair, and overhaul services related to ships and other vessels. The key finding is the clarification of tax credit utilization for landowner-promoters and the explicit inclusion of specific services in the tax framework.

**5. Key Provisions / Changes:**
This notification introduces two key changes to the existing Union Territory Tax Rate notification:
* **a) Landowner-Promoter Tax Credit:**
* **Original Policy Part Affected:** Conditions in column 5 of serial number 3 in the Table of Notification No. 11/2017, specifically the fourth proviso and the Explanation.
* **New Rule/Provision:** A new clause (iii) is inserted after clause (ii) in the Explanation, stating: "the landownerpromoter shall be eligible to utilise the credit of tax charged to him by the developer promoter for payment of tax on apartments supplied by the landownerpromoter in such project."
* **Effect of Change:** This change explicitly allows landowner-promoters to utilize the input tax credit received from developer-promoters to pay taxes on apartments supplied by them within the project. This provides a clearer framework for tax liability and credit utilization within real estate development projects involving landowner-promoters.
* **b) Maintenance, Repair, and Overhaul Services for Ships:**
* **Original Policy Part Affected:** Serial number 25 in the Table of Notification No. 11/2017.
* **New Rule/Provision:** An item ia after item ia is introduced: "ib Maintenance, repair or overhaul services in respect of ships and other vessels, their engines and other components or parts." Tax rate is set at 2.5
Item ii in column 3, ,ia and ib shall be substituted.
* **Effect of Change:** The new entry specifically addresses Maintenance, repair or overhaul services in respect of ships and other vessels, their engines and other components or parts. The service is now subjected to UTGST and can be assumed to have addressed any ambiguity in applying taxes to services related to ships and other vessels.

MINISTRY OF FINANCE
(Department of Revenue)
NOTIFICATION
New Delhi, the 2nd June, 2021
No. 02/2021- Union Territory Tax (Rate)
G.S.R. 379(E).—In exercise of the powers conferred by sub-sections (1), (3) and (4) of section 7,
sub-section (1) of section 8, clauses (iv), (v) and (xxvii) of section 21 of the Union Territory Goods and
Services Tax Act, 2017 (14 of 2017), read with sub-section (5) of section 15, sub-section (1) of section 16 and
section 148 of the Central Goods and Services Tax Act, 2017 (12 of 2017), the Central Government, on the
recommendations of the Council, and on being satisfied that it is necessary in the public interest so to do,
hereby makes the following further amendments in the notification of the Government of India, in the Ministry
of Finance (Department of Revenue) No.11/2017- Union Territory Tax (Rate), dated the 28thJune, 2017,
published in the Gazette of India, Extraordinary, Part II, Section 3, Sub-section (i), vide number G.S.R.
702(E), dated the 28thJune, 2017, namely:-
In the said notification, in the Table, -
(a) in serial number 3, against items (i), (ia), (ib), (ic) and (id) in column (3) , in the conditions in column
(5), in the fourth proviso, in the Explanation, after clause (ii), the following clause shall be inserted,
namely-
―(iii) the landowner-promoter shall be eligible to utilise the credit of tax charged to him by the developer-
promoter for payment of tax on apartments supplied by the landowner-promoter in such project.‖ ;
(b) in serial number 25,-
(i) after item (ia) in column (3) and the entries relating thereto, in columns (3), (4) and (5), the following
items and entries shall be inserted, namely –[भाग II—खण् ड 3(i)] भारत का रािपत्र : असाधारण 3
(3) (4) (5)
―(ib) Maintenance, repair or overhaul services
in respect of ships and other vessels, their 2.5 -‖
engines and other components or parts.
(ii) in item (ii) in column (3), for the word, brackets, figures and letter ― and (ia)‖, the brackets, figures,
letter and word ―,(ia) and (ib)‖ shall be substituted.
2. This notification shall come into force with effect from the 2nd day of June, 2021.
[F. No. 354/53/2021 -TRU]
RAJEEV RANJAN, Under Secy.
Note : The principal notification No. 11/2017 - Union Territory Tax (Rate), dated the 28th June, 2017 was
published in the Gazette of India, Extraordinary, vide number G.S.R. 702(E), dated the 28th June,
2017 and was last amended by Notification No. 02/2020- Union Territory Tax (Rate), the 26th
March, 2020 vide number G.S.R. 223(E), dated the 26th March, 2020.
